Why Nickel Free Pots And Pans Is Necessary

I started paying attention to nickel-free pots and pans when I realized how often I cook every day and how much contact my food has with my cookware. For me, choosing nickel-free options became important because I wanted to reduce the chance of nickel exposure, especially if someone in the household has a nickel sensitivity or allergy. Even small amounts can matter, and using safer cookware gives me peace of mind.

I also like that nickel-free pots and pans can be a better choice for people who want cleaner cooking habits. When I prepare meals, I want to know my cookware is not adding unwanted metals into my food, particularly when cooking acidic dishes like tomato sauce. It makes me feel more confident about what I’m serving to myself and my family.

For me, it is not just about allergies—it is also about long-term health awareness and making thoughtful choices in the kitchen. Nickel-free cookware helps me cook with less worry and more comfort, which is why I see it as a necessary option rather than just a preference.

My Buying Guides on Nickel Free Pots And Pans

Why I Look for Nickel Free Cookware

When I started paying closer attention to what my cookware was made of, I realized that nickel can be a concern for people with allergies or sensitivities. I wanted pots and pans that would let me cook comfortably without worrying about nickel exposure. For me, choosing nickel free cookware is about peace of mind, safer everyday cooking, and finding materials that fit my kitchen needs.

What I Check Before Buying

Before I buy any pot or pan, I look at the material first. I make sure the product clearly states that it is nickel free, because some cookware may still contain small amounts of nickel in stainless steel or coatings. I also check whether the cookware is non-reactive, durable, easy to clean, and suitable for the type of cooking I do most often.

Best Materials I Trust

From my experience, the materials I trust most for nickel free cooking are:

  • Cast iron: Great for heat retention and long-lasting use.
  • Carbon steel: Lightweight, strong, and excellent for high-heat cooking.
  • Pure ceramic: A good option when I want a non-metal surface.
  • Glass cookware: Useful for oven cooking and food storage.
  • Aluminum with nickel-free coating: Only if the manufacturer clearly confirms it is nickel free.

What I Avoid

I usually avoid cookware that does not clearly list its materials. Many stainless steel products can contain nickel, so I do not assume they are safe just because they look high quality. I also stay away from cheap cookware with vague labeling, because I want to know exactly what I am cooking with.

How I Judge Durability

For me, a good nickel free pan should last a long time without warping, chipping, or losing its finish. I look for strong construction, thick bases, and trusted brands with clear product details. If I am buying cast iron or carbon steel, I also consider whether I am willing to season and maintain it properly.

Ease of Cleaning Matters to Me

I always think about cleanup before I buy. Some nickel free cookware, like cast iron, needs more care, while ceramic and glass are usually easier to wash. I choose based on how much maintenance I am willing to do. If I want convenience, I look for cookware that cleans easily without harsh scrubbing.

Heat Performance I Prefer

I want cookware that heats evenly and responds well to my stove. Cast iron holds heat very well, which is great for searing and slow cooking. Carbon steel heats quickly and works well for stir-frying. Ceramic and glass are useful too, but I make sure they match the cooking style I use most.

Safety and Compatibility Checks

I always confirm whether the cookware is safe for my stove type. Some pieces work on gas, electric, induction, or oven use, while others do not. I also check handle materials, oven-safe temperature limits, and whether any coatings are free from unwanted metals.

My Final Buying Tip

My best advice is to buy only from brands that clearly label their cookware as nickel free and explain exactly what materials they use. I feel more confident when I can verify the product details instead of guessing. When I focus on material, durability, cleaning, and cooking performance, I end up with cookware that fits my kitchen and my health needs.
